Her work integrates client-centered therapy with cognitive behavioral techniques and emotionally focused interventions. Client-centered therapy emphasizes empathic listening and collaboration to clarify goals and values. Cognitive behavioral therapy offers structured ways to notice and test unhelpful thoughts and to develop practical coping strategies. Emotionally focused techniques are used to explore and process relational and attachment-related feelings in a focused way.
